计算机是由硬件资源和软件资源构成的。硬件资源是指计算机的物理设备,包括中央处理器(CPU)、内存、硬盘、显卡等。这些硬件设备是计算机运行的基础,它们负责处理数据、存储信息和执行程序。
软件资源是指计算机的程序和数据,包括操作系统、数据库管理系统、编程语言、应用程序等。这些软件资源是计算机的灵魂,它们提供了各种功能和服务,使计算机能够完成各种任务。
硬件资源和软件资源相互依赖,共同构成了计算机系统。硬件资源为软件资源提供了运行环境,而软件资源则通过与硬件资源的交互来实现各种功能。例如,操作系统通过管理硬件资源来为用户提供各种服务,如文件管理、网络通信等;应用程序则通过调用操作系统提供的接口来实现特定的功能。
硬件资源和软件资源之间还存在着密切的关系。一方面,硬件资源的性能和稳定性直接影响到软件资源的性能和稳定性;另一方面,软件资源的设计和管理也会影响到硬件资源的配置和使用。因此,在设计和使用计算机系统时,需要充分考虑硬件资源和软件资源之间的匹配性和协同性,以确保系统的稳定运行和高效性能。